MOSCOW — September 19, 2026

Today, Russia is conducting parliamentary elections that for the first time include voters from regions of Ukraine that were annexed by Russia. This development is significant not only for the electoral process within Russia but also for the ongoing geopolitical tensions surrounding the conflict in Ukraine.

The elections are taking place in the backdrop of Russia’s controversial annexation of Crimea in 2014 and the subsequent incorporation of parts of eastern Ukraine, including Donetsk and Luhansk, into Russian territory. The decision to allow residents of these regions to participate in the parliamentary elections represents a strategic move by the Russian government to legitimize its claims over these territories and further integrate them into the Russian political framework.

According to reports from Serbian News Media, the elections are being held across Russia, with polling stations set up in the annexed regions to accommodate voters. This inclusion has drawn criticism from Ukraine and many Western nations, which view the elections as illegal and a violation of international law. The Ukrainian government has condemned the elections, asserting that they undermine Ukraine’s sovereignty and territorial integrity.

The Russian government, led by President Vladimir Putin, has framed the elections as a demonstration of democracy and a reflection of the will of the people in these regions. However, the legitimacy of this claim is widely disputed, as the elections are taking place under conditions of military occupation and amidst ongoing conflict.

This electoral development is receiving heightened attention now due to its implications for international relations and the potential for escalating tensions between Russia and the West. The inclusion of these territories in the electoral process could embolden Russian claims over the regions and complicate diplomatic efforts aimed at resolving the conflict in Ukraine.

As the results of the elections are anticipated, analysts are closely monitoring the potential ramifications for both domestic and international politics. The outcome could influence Russia’s legislative agenda and its approach to the ongoing conflict in Ukraine, as well as shape the responses from Western nations.

Looking ahead, the international community may respond with renewed sanctions or diplomatic efforts to counter Russia’s actions in Ukraine. The situation remains fluid, and the implications of these elections will likely reverberate beyond Russia’s borders, affecting geopolitical dynamics in Eastern Europe and beyond.
